has anybody else seen them? all I can say is WOW!

a local casino had them in on Saturday night for a free show. I was blown away. having seen zep in Detroit in '77, and watched a fair amount of other material, I can say they are pretty much spot on.

the singer was great- had plant's stage presence, and a voice to match. the page player looked like he had pretty much the same equipment as page, and did a great job.

the drummer was super too-looked a bit like bonzo, and was a super player. the bass player also double on keyboards like jones.

great experience if you get a chance to see them

We have a couple of local Zepplin bands. One, Zed Lepplin is a tribute band complete w/ costumes and whether make-up or natural, they bear a striking resemblance as well. They have obviously practiced Bonzo & the Boys mannerisms, though I think the lead singer plays Plant a little too effeminate (notice I said a little). Their play is very good and they've been booked in Vegas, L.A., AC, NOLA and a Cruise Ship.

The other is a local cover band - Whole Lotta Zep. These guys are all Zepplin Fanatics who play in other bands, but book dates together to do Zep. I think they actually play better than Zed Lepplin. The lead guitar actually uses a Telecaster when performing 'Stairway' further lending to authenticity.

Either way, I'm such a Zepplin fan that I catch each of their shows whenever they're booked around here and am never disappointed.
